EWP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review
106 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ares MSCI Spain ETF (EWP)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$883M — up 23% from $719M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 22 funds opened new EWP positions and 10 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 36 added to existing stakes and 31 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Bank of Nova Scotia, adding an estimated $118M. The largest seller was National Pension Service, cutting an estimated $23.6M.
